Ingredients for Oven Fried Potatoes & Onions

  • 4 large russet potatoes, peeled and cut into thin slices
  • 2 medium onions, thinly sliced
  • 3 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ried thyme (or your favorite herb)
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• Optional: Fresh parsley for garnish

Equipment Needed

  • Baking sheet
  • Parchment paper or aluminum foil
  • Mixing bowl
  • Knife and cutting board

Instructions for Perfect Oven Fried Potatoes & Onions

  1. Preheat the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). This temperature is ideal for getting the potatoes crispy without overcooking them.
  2. Prepare the Potatoes: Peel and slice the potatoes into thin rounds. The thinner the slices, the crispier the potatoes will be. Aim for slices that are about 1/4-inch thick.
  3. Slice the Onions: Slice the onions thinly. The onions will caramelize as they cook, adding a sweet, savory flavor to the dish.
  4. Season the Potatoes and Onions: In a large mixing bowl, toss the potato slices and onion slices with olive oil, garlic powder, paprika, dried thyme, salt, and pepper. Make sure everything is evenly coated for maximum flavor.
  5. Arrange on the Baking Sheet: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or aluminum foil for easy cleanup. Spread the seasoned potato and onion mixture evenly across the baking sheet. Ensure the slices are in a single layer to promote even cooking.
  6. Bake to Crispy Perfection: Place the baking sheet in the preheated oven and bake for 25–30 minutes, flipping the potatoes halfway through the cooking time. The potatoes should be golden brown and crispy when done. If you like your potatoes extra crispy, leave them in the oven for an additional 5–10 minutes, keeping an eye on them to prevent burning.
  7. Garnish and Serve: Once the potatoes and onions are perfectly baked, remove them from the oven. If desired, sprinkle with fresh parsley for a pop of color and added freshness.
  8. Enjoy: Serve your oven-fried potatoes and onions hot as a side dish, snack, or even in a salad. These crispy, tender, and flavorful bites will be a hit at any meal!

Tips for the Best Oven Fried Potatoes & Onions

  • Cut the Potatoes Evenly: For the best results, slice your potatoes uniformly. This will ensure they cook at the same rate and become evenly crispy.
  • Use a High-Quality Olive Oil: A good olive oil will add richness to the dish and help the potatoes crisp up nicely.
  • Customize with Your Favorite Spices: Feel free to experiment with different spices. Add some cumin for warmth, rosemary for an herbal flavor, or a pinch of chili powder for heat.
  • Add Cheese: For a cheesy twist, sprinkle grated Parmesan cheese over the potatoes and onions during the last 5 minutes of baking.
  • Double the Recipe: This dish is a crowd-pleaser, so make extra if you’re serving a large group. Leftovers can easily be reheated in the oven for a second round of crispy goodness.
